Specifications
Voltage - Input Offset: 2mV
Base Part Number: MAX9628
Supplier Device Package: 12-TQFN (3x3)
Package / Case: 12-WFQFN Exposed Pad
Mounting Type: Surface Mount
Operating Temperature: -40°C ~ 125°C
Voltage - Supply, Single/Dual (±): 2.85 V ~ 5.25 V
Current - Output / Channel: 100mA
Current - Supply: 59mA
Series: --
Current - Input Bias: 1µA
-3db Bandwidth: 1GHz
Slew Rate: 5500 V/µs
Output Type: Differential
Number of Circuits: 1
Amplifier Type: Differential
Part Status: Last Time Buy
Packaging: Tape & Reel (TR)

In terms of operation principle, an IA is a type of op-amp circuit that provides very high input impedance and low offset voltage. Basically, the IA is a three-opamp configuration, each op-amp stage being a differential amplifier. The first op-amp at the input stage amplifies the differential input signal with a gain determined by the resistors R1 and R2. The second op-amp, known as the summing amplifier, allows to adjust the output gain of the IA by changing the voltage applied to its non-inverting input. The third op-amp, called the output stage, buffers the output of the IA, providing the required voltage to drive the load. Since the IA is a differential amplifier, it rejects common-mode signals with a high common mode rejection ratio.
